I thought that if oncce your temp went up after oing it was supposed to stay up for a little while? Is that wrong? Mine dropped today

Your temp is still above the cover line so that's good. Also, some women experience a drop in temp during implantation, so maybe that's why yours dropped. Let's hope that's the reason for the drop. It should go back up tomorrow

As long as your temperature remains above your cover line, it's generally nothing to worry about.

Remember that you are watching for a pattern in your temps. Don't get caught up on day to day fluctuations as individual temperatures don't mean much.

It is possible that you are experiencing an implantation dip, it's also possible that it's just a fluctuation in temps. If it makes you feel any better, I had a larger drop than yours at 6 DPO this past cycle... so it's certainly not abnormal.

Your temp doesn't necessarily stay up the whole time during the 2ww. It should stay above the coverline though. You will often see your temperature drop around 6-10 dpo and then go back up. It is nothing to worry about.
